Everything went out the window for Nkosi Solomon on Saturday night despite an encouraging first round of pro boxing.

The 23 year-old former amateur star rolled over in the paid ranks but met a determined Matt Cameron in Chicago.

Cameron proved no slouch, and when Solomon’s tactics left him in the second round, ‘Big Cam’ took full advantage.

Solomon was dropped in the third and fourth rounds on his way to a shocking first loss but it was what promoter Eddie Hearn said after the fight that will live long in the memory.

Heading backstage to seek out Solomon, Hearn gave an incredibly inspirational pep talk to the American.

“You have to work on the fundamentals but we are one hundred percent behind you,” said Hearn.

“Nothing has changed for us from before this fight.

“It doesn’t matter the way were are going to promote you. You could have won tonight. Nothing’s changed.

“You’ve got to stiffen up that jab. It’s okay because God tests you sometimes and this is your test. It’s all about what you’ve got in your heart.

“But I’m not going to put you in a ring again until you are ready. Because if you lose your career is over. Next time there’ll be no excuses.

“Fundamentals of boxing is what you’ve got to work on. The first round was perfect when you were using the jab. In the second round, your jab went.

“It’s done. There’s no point talking about it. You take it on the chin and you go again,” he added in a video filmed by Matchroom Boxing USA.

Solomon is hopeful of being back out in December, although Hearn wants to assess the heavyweight beforehand.

Dates in January or February could also be possible as Solomon bids to put his nightmare start at the Wintrust Arena behind him.
